Calvary Christian Academy was not able to break out of their rough patch on Thursday as the team picked up their fourth straight loss. They lost 3-0 to the Archbishop McCarthy Mavericks. If the Eagles were looking for revenge after losing 3-1 to the Mavericks when the teams met back in September of 2024, then they'll just have to keep looking.
Calvary Christian Academy couldn't get the win, but they sure gave Archbishop McCarthy a tough time in the third set.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-17, 25-17, 30-28.
Jada Stephenson paced Calvary Christian Academy's offense, picking up 11 kills. Stephenson got some help from Kaia Mittauer and her 13 assists.
Calvary Christian Academy's defeat dropped their record down to 8-10. As for Archbishop McCarthy, the win (which was their seventh in a row) raised their record to 17-3.
Calvary Christian Academy has already played their next contest, a 3-0 loss against Saint Andrew's on the 29th. As for Archbishop McCarthy, they will take on Coral Springs Charter at 4:30 p.m. on Wednesday.
